Output e8323a2588ab122240fd417fe3bb0c1cbdd6840bd82dd53f96348115427c88dc:1

value
707320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6de0843a5cfbdf35f969eb955327220e272ded6 OP_EQUAL
address
3NjjKjmUEoAdYkQuGUK2boS6RmdbKue4VU
transaction
e8323a2588ab122240fd417fe3bb0c1cbdd6840bd82dd53f96348115427c88dc
confirmations
437464
spent
true